Mario Party 8 is a classic title, but its lack of native widescreen support during gameplay has long been a point of frustration for fans. While the menus and title screen display in 16:9, the actual board play and minigames are locked in a 4:3 ratio, often filled with colorful but distracting decorative borders.
But if you’ve tried to revisit the game recently on modern hardware via emulation, you likely hit a wall of black bars. Like many Wii titles from that era, Mario Party 8 was designed for standard 4:3 televisions. Playing it in widescreen meant a stretched, distorted image that made our favorite plumbers look wider than they are tall. mario party 8 widescreen mod
